Ready to take your marketing career to the next level? We’re looking for a Marketing Administrator to join our fast‑paced, creative B2B marketing team!
You’ll plan and run multi‑channel campaigns, create engaging content, manage events, and turn leads into real opportunities – all while collaborating with brilliant people and bringing bold ideas to life.
What You’ll Do
- Lead Generation: Run smart, data‑driven campaigns that deliver qualified leads.
- Content & Social: Create scroll‑stopping posts, blogs, and videos (AI tools welcome!).
- Events: Plan and host epic in‑person & virtual events that drive engagement and growth.
- Projects & Reporting: Keep campaigns on track, analyse performance, and celebrate wins.
- Team Support: Mentor coordinators, liaise with partners, and ensure everything runs smoothly.
You Bring
- Proven B2B marketing experience (admin, coordination, or team lead).
- Strong project management & content skills.
- Proficiency with HubSpot, Canva, Office 365, and LinkedIn Sales Navigator.

How to prepare for a job interview at Henderson Scott Careers
✨Know Your Marketing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your B2B marketing knowledge. Familiarise yourself with the latest trends, tools like HubSpot and Canva, and be ready to discuss how you've used them in past campaigns. This shows you're not just a candidate; you're a marketing enthusiast!
✨Showcase Your Creativity
Prepare examples of your best content – think scroll-stopping posts or engaging blogs. Bring along a portfolio if you can! This is your chance to demonstrate how you can create impactful content that resonates with audiences.
✨Event Planning Skills Are Key
Since you'll be planning events, think of a couple of successful events you've organised. Be ready to discuss the challenges you faced and how you overcame them. This will highlight your project management skills and ability to drive engagement.
✨Be a Team Player
Collaboration is crucial in this role. Prepare to talk about how you've supported your team in the past, mentored others, or liaised with partners. Show that you can bring people together and keep everything running smoothly!
